Output 8e6c830aec6a860ad181520dd7c2ce7e74cebcef9e110bc4b0dc724474ff7b70: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b27fef05968048da660478f728d310baedff7b OP_EQUAL
address
34mC4FfKLYq6kj9HtdpNEjGstimcVrKE3E
transaction
8e6c830aec6a860ad181520dd7c2ce7e74cebcef9e110bc4b0dc724474ff7b70
confirmations
454908
spent
true